0

对于 Word 2013,我正在尝试在 Javascript 中实现一个函数,该函数可以删除 MS Word 文档中两个索引之间的整个字符串。我为 Word 找到的 API 不允许我们做任何此类事情(MS 网站上提供的示例涉及替换选定的代码)。是否有任何可用的 API 来做同样的事情?提前致谢。(我们正在 Visual Studio 中开发,并正在尝试创建一个 Office 应用程序)

4

1 回答 1

0

评论中提到的 Office JS API 扩展集仅适用于 Word 2016。此扩展集使您能够搜索整个文档。

对于 Word 2013,您唯一的办法是让用户选择整个文档,然后获取 Word Open XML(2013 API 确实允许您这样做)。这将返回 OPC 平面文件格式的 OOXML。您可以使用标准的 XML 编辑工具在其中进行搜索和替换 - 确保结果是有效的 Word Open XML!- 然后将其写回选择。

于 2015-11-08T06:46:40.760 回答